On Friday, August 09, 2013 7:24:29 am Attilio Rao wrote: > Author: attilio > Date: Fri Aug 9 11:24:29 2013 > New Revision: 254139 > URL: http://svnweb.freebsd.org/changeset/base/254139 > > Log: > Give mutex(9) the ability to recurse on a per-instance basis. > Now the MTX_RECURSE flag can be passed to the mtx_*_flag() calls. > This helps in cases we want to narrow down to specific calls the > possibility to recurse for some locks.
It would perhaps be better for the ops passed to WITNESS to be opt-in rather than opt-out, so that you use 'opts & LOP_QUIET | foo' rather than 'opts & ~MTX_RECURSE | foo'. -- John Baldwin _______________________________________________ [email protected] mailing list http://lists.freebsd.org/mailman/listinfo/svn-src-all To unsubscribe, send any mail to "[email protected]"
